This config:
disk = [
'phy:/dev/hosting2_data2/XEN_freebsd_root,0x01,w',
'phy:/dev/hosting2_data2/XEN_freebsd_swap,0x02,w'
]
Gives this output in dmesg:
xbd0: 10240MB <Virtual Block Device> at device/vbd/1 on xenbus0
GEOM: new disk xbd0
xbd1: 512MB <Virtual Block Device> at device/vbd/2 on xenbus0
WARNING: WITNESS option enabled, expect reduced performance.
GEOM: new disk xbd0
and then ls -l /dev/xbd* :
freebsd_domu# ls -l /dev/xbd*
crw-r----- 1 root operator 0, 41 May 18 02:51 /dev/xbd0
crw-r----- 1 root operator 0, 41 May 18 02:51 /dev/xbd0
Hm, I wonder whats busted!
